Netfx20sp1 Upd [top] ●

NetFx20SP1 is not just a patch; it acts as a foundational component for newer frameworks. It provides prerequisite feature support for NET Framework 3.0 Service Pack 1 and NET Framework 3.5 . This means that installing netfx20sp1 is often necessary before upgrading to these later versions. Supported Operating Systems

Released later, SP1 served as a cumulative update to 2.0, fixing bugs, improving performance, and enhancing security.

The base .NET Framework 2.0 SP1 is missing, or you are using a newer .NET version (e.g., 3.5) without the 2.0 SP1 component.

Necessary for installing or running .NET Framework 3.0 SP1 and .NET Framework 3.5.

This must be installed on your system before attempting the update.

In the landscape of software development and system administration, keeping legacy applications running smoothly while maintaining security is a constant challenge. For organizations still relying on older software, the —or .NET Framework 2.0 Service Pack 1 updates —remains a critical component for system stability and security.

While "NetFX20SP1 upd" was once a critical patch for Windows XP and Vista users, it is now largely obsolete. For modern systems, the best course of action is to enable the .NET Framework 3.5 feature built into Windows. For legacy systems still running on hardware from that era, ensuring the system is offline or strictly firewalled is highly recommended due to the lack of security patches.

If you are seeing error messages related to an update for NetFX20SP1 (often appearing as error code or similar in Windows Update logs), it usually indicates one of two things:

After applying SP1, the main runtime files (e.g., mscorlib.dll ) will have the version number 2.0.50727.1433 .

Windows Server 2008, on the other hand, includes these service packs by default. Therefore, no additional installation was required for that operating system to have the SP1 updates applied.